Board & Batten's Place in Bellingham's Building Style

Board and batten shows up all over Bellingham right now — on new farmhouse-style builds, on older homes getting a full exterior refresh, and as an accent panel on gables and entry walls paired with standard lap siding. Part of the appeal is visual: the vertical lines read as taller, cleaner, and more architectural than a flat lap wall. But board and batten was originally a functional profile before it was a fashionable one, built from wide boards with a narrow strip covering each seam to keep weather out of a barn or outbuilding wall. That history matters, because the same thing that makes the look work — more vertical seams, more edges, more places where two pieces of material meet — is also what makes this profile less forgiving of a sloppy install than plain lap siding.

What This Corner of Whatcom County Puts a Wall Through

Salt Air Off Bellingham Bay

Homes closer to the water deal with a steady, low-level dose of salt-laden air, and that air is hard on exposed metal and on finishes that aren't built to handle it. Board and batten uses more fasteners per square foot than lap siding, since both the boards and the battens have to be secured, so a fastener spec that isn't corrosion-resistant shows up as rust streaks and staining sooner on this profile than on most others.

Driving Rain That Doesn't Fall Straight Down

Wind coming off the bay pushes rain sideways more often than it falls straight down, and vertical battens running the full height of a wall give that wind-driven rain a long, continuous seam to test. A batten sealed with caulk instead of proper lap and clearance becomes a place where water gets pushed in rather than shed off.

A Moss Season That Runs Most of the Year

Shaded walls, north-facing exposures, and anywhere tree cover keeps a wall from drying out fully between storms are where moss and mildew take hold fastest, and in this climate that season stretches across most of the year, not just the wettest months. A batten set tight against its board with no room to vent traps that moisture right at the seam, which is exactly where you don't want it sitting.

Why We Only Put James Hardie on a Board & Batten Wall

More seams means more exposed material edges, and that amplifies whatever a siding product's weak points already are. Cedar and primed spruce board and batten need a recurring paint or stain cycle to keep every one of those seams sealed, and missing a cycle shows up as moisture absorption right where boards and battens meet. Vinyl board and batten relies on a track-and-clip system that has more room to warp or gap when there's this much seam length involved, and once a gap opens it's hard to catch from the ground. LP SmartSide and other engineered-wood panels perform reasonably when every cut edge and fastener hole is sealed correctly, but that's a lot of edges to get right consistently across a whole board and batten wall, and any edge that's missed becomes a point where the wood-based core can start absorbing moisture.

None of that means those products are junk — plenty of contractors install them well. We made a professional call that on a profile this dependent on joint-level detailing, in a climate this wet, we'd rather stand behind one material system across every job than manage several sets of trade-offs. James Hardie's fiber cement core doesn't swell or move at a seam the way wood-based materials can, its HZ product lines are engineered for exactly the wet, marine conditions this region sees, and the factory-applied ColorPlus finish means the color coat isn't something a field crew has to get right on site — it's baked on before the boards ever arrive. Hardie also backs its material with a long transferable warranty, which matters on a siding profile that's genuinely difficult and expensive to redo if it's installed wrong the first time.

Comparing Board & Batten Material Options in This Climate

MaterialBehavior at Batten SeamsUpkeep in Salt Air & RainRealistic Lifespan Here
James Hardie fiber cementStable; doesn't swell, cup, or shift at the jointLow; factory finish resists moss and salt exposure30+ years installed to spec
Cedar / primed spruceAbsorbs moisture at every seam without regular sealingHigh; recurring paint or stain cycle required15-25 years with consistent upkeep
VinylTrack-and-clip seams can warp or gap over timeLow visible upkeep, but hidden moisture is hard to catch20-30 years, variable
LP SmartSide (engineered wood)Sensitive at cut edges and fastener holes if sealing is missedModerate; edge sealing needs ongoing attention15-25 years, climate-dependent

The pattern across every alternative is the same: performance depends on a maintenance step happening on schedule, year after year, for the life of the siding. Fiber cement's advantage on this profile specifically is that it doesn't ask for that ongoing intervention at the seams to keep performing.

Even a straightforward board and batten job has more variables affecting scope than a comparable lap-siding project. The condition of the wall underneath matters more here, since any hidden moisture damage found during tear-off has to be dealt with before new siding goes up, not covered over. Wall height, the number of window and door openings, and how tight the batten spacing is all add labor beyond the base material cost, because every one of those elements adds seams and transitions that need proper detailing. We walk each home individually rather than pricing off square footage alone, since two houses the same size can call for very different amounts of work depending on how many of these factors are actually in play.

The Installation Details That Actually Determine Whether It Holds Up

Drainage Plane and Rainscreen Gap

A correctly built wall has a weather-resistive barrier installed and lapped before any siding goes up, with a drainage gap or rainscreen behind the boards so moisture that does get past the surface can dry out instead of sitting against the sheathing. On a profile with this many seams, that gap is doing more work than it would behind a plain lap wall.

Fastening and Batten Reveal

Boards and battens both need corrosion-resistant fasteners at the spacing Hardie's installation spec calls for — not just enough nails to hold the material up. Battens also need the clearance the spec calls for rather than being caulked down tight, so the wall can shed water instead of trapping it against the substrate.

Flashing at Windows, Corners, and Transitions

Every place a vertical run of board and batten meets a window, door, corner, or the base of the wall is a transition that needs its own flashing and lap detail. These are also the spots where a rushed install is most likely to leave a gap, and where a small gap does the most damage over time because it sits behind material that's harder to inspect than a flat lap wall.

What to Watch For Once It's Installed

Fiber cement board and batten needs very little attention compared to wood or vinyl, but it's still worth knowing what to look for, especially on shaded or water-facing walls:

  • Moss or dark staining building up along a batten seam, especially on north-facing or tree-shaded walls
  • A gap opening up at a butt joint between two boards where there wasn't one before
  • Rust-colored streaking running down from a fastener location
  • Chalking or noticeable fading of the factory finish well ahead of schedule
  • Soft spots or discoloration at the base of the wall near grade or a deck ledger
  • Caulk that's cracked or pulled away from a window or trim transition

Catching any of these early is usually a small fix. Left alone through a few more wet seasons, they tend to become bigger ones.

How is board and batten actually installed — is it different from standard siding?

Board and batten uses wide vertical boards with a narrow strip called a batten covering each seam, instead of the horizontal overlapping boards used in lap siding. That means more total seams and fasteners over the same wall area, so the drainage gap, fastener spacing, and batten clearance behind the material matter more here than on a typical lap install.

Does James Hardie's board and batten siding need to be painted after it's installed?

No — Hardie's ColorPlus boards come with a factory-applied, baked-on finish in the color you choose, so field work is mostly limited to priming cut edges rather than painting the whole wall. That factory finish is also backed by its own warranty against fading and chalking.

Does being close to Bellingham Bay change how board and batten should be built?

It changes what matters most, not whether the profile works. Corrosion-resistant fasteners, correctly spaced batten joints, and a working drainage gap matter more the closer a home sits to the water, and getting those details right is what lets board and batten hold up fine in a marine environment like this one.
